iRobot Roomba s9+

The iRobot Roomba S9+ robot vacuum is one of the best-rated robots. It comes with a variety of features and incredible cleaning power, including an area for dirt that is integrated into the charging base. This robot can learn your habits of cleaning, and suggest automated schedules to give you the ultimate hands-free cleaning experience.

The setup process is simple thanks to the iRobot Home app that walks you through the process. Once the system is setup, you can start automatic cleaning with a single button press. You can choose the general clean option that focuses on the removal of larger pieces of debris like cereal and rice. Or you can opt for two thorough mappings to ensure that the entire home is cleaned thoroughly.

This robot vacuum is effective on both floors with no carpet and carpets with low pile. It is able to pick up pet hair and clean big objects up. It doesn't lose suction as quickly as other robot vacuums. It's a challenge with plush or high-pile carpets, but iRobot claims that future models will be more efficient.

The S9+ features a new design from iRobot that focuses on enhancing edge and corner cleaning. It's the very first Roomba that adopts a flat-fronted D-shaped design. The company hopes that this will allow it to fit into furniture and walls. It's a great improvement over the standard hockey puck shape of most robovacs, though we found it to be only marginally better than circular models.

iRobot claims that the S9+ also features a superior filtration system which blocks microscopic particles and allergens recirculating throughout your home. We like the claim, but not enough to justify a higher price.

Its intelligent navigation system makes use of sensors to keep track of the layout of your home and vSLAM for mapping the interior of your home. This allows it to stay clear of obstacles, such as stairs and other barriers, and to tidy up your entire home in the most efficient manner possible. The iRobot Home app lets you control the robot and set cleaning times, and create virtual boundary markers, so that it is aware of areas that require extra attention.

2. Roborock Q Revo

Roborock Q Revo is a robot that combines mopping and vacuuming. Its vacuum settings are just as good as those found on more expensive models. Its mopping system is superior - its spinning pads scrub floors more effectively than the vibrating pads.

The only issue is that it doesn't have an additional rubber brush to allow for deeper cleaning, but that's a small cost to pay for if you want to get one of the best robots on the market. The dust tank of the robo-vac is bigger than most of its competitors. Filling it takes just two or three cycles, even when you've got a lot of dirt.

As for the mopping device, I was impressed with its ability to scrub off tough dirt from my floors. The two lowest mopping settings that are less powerful than the high-powered modes, produce very little noise, so you can work or watch television without being distracted. If it encounters a wall or piece of furniture, it gently bumps into it and then moves forward.

What really distinguishes the Q Revo apart is that it's designed to run nearly completely on its own, with no need for human intervention. The robo-vac has a multifunction dock that automatically transfers physical garbage into the hidden bin and also washes and dry the mop pads and refills its clean water tank. The app is good at alerting you when something requires attention, for example, the water tank being empty or a scheduled cleaning session that was cancelled due to a stuffed dust bin.

You can also design and merge rooms to modify the way that Q Revo will treat your home. This feature is beneficial if you have different flooring in different areas of your house or in the event that you have to regularly remove clutter, such as toys, clothes, and books. The robo-vac is also efficient and was one of the top performers in my tests, removing debris from carpets as well as hardwood floors in the first attempt. It can even vacuum up wet spills. I recommend drying the area with a towel prior to sending it to.

3. Ecovacs Deebot X2 Omni

The X2 Omni has all of the features you'd expect from a top-quality robot vacuum and mop and more. Similar to the iRobot Roomba S9+, it has an excellent vacuum with a powerful suction to clean hard and carpet floors, plus an omni-rotating mop that scrubs tough stains. It also comes with an auto-cleaning station that automatically washes and cleans the mop pads to keep them fresh and ready for reuse. It also comes with a brand new sensor system that better detects obstacles, granting it the ability to prevent falling over furniture and other objects.

The most significant improvement over the ECOVACS the X1 Deebot is its sleeker, modern design. This is thanks to Danish company Jacob Jensen Design, best known for their Bang & Olufsen product line. The robot is still big. It has a height of more than two feet the height and depth and weighs in at least four pounds. However the robot and its base are smaller than the Roborock Q Revo and iRobot J7.

This version is also more efficient than the X1, as it has faster battery charging and can complete a cleaning of about 1,500 square feet on one charge. And it has a larger, more durable dustbin to hold more debris which makes it easier to empty it when needed.

The X2 Omni also has a more natural voice assistant as well as an app that is functional even if you are not at home. It also comes with more mopping modes and a smart routing feature that gives it the flexibility to clean specific areas or rooms of your home instead just following a set path.

The X2 Omni is the top mopping robot. Its mop pads that rotate remove tough stains and its motor creates a lot of downward pressure. Its vacuuming is excellent as well and it enhances suction when it senses carpets to ensure that it does a thorough job. It also has a huge battery that can last for several weeks between charges and its mopping mode is as efficient as any we've seen in an ordinary robot.

4. Dreametech L10s Ultra

The Dreametech L10s Ultra is a top-quality mop and vacuum robot that comes with a variety of convenience features you aren't likely to find on robots at this price. It can make detailed floor maps and identify various flooring types. It's also among the few robots that can automatically clean and dry its mop pad. While these features are nice to have, they also push the L10s Ultra into the luxury category, which might make it a little more expensive than the average homeowner require.

The L10s Ultra looks like a modern floor cleaning machine. It is slim and tall with a white finish accented with silver elements and mirror plating. The front of the machine is dominated by a huge bumper that helps protect furniture and vacuum cleaners from damage when moving through the house. Sensors are concealed behind the front panel, which help the L10s Ultra navigate around tight corners and avoid obstacles.

On the top, there's one button that is a switch for on and off. Clicking this will turn on the vacuum, while clicking it again will turn off the vacuum and return it to its base station. The circular menu in the middle of the control panel allows users to select cleaning options or schedules, as well as preferences. The left and right buttons on the screen will open up the settings menu of the app where you can tweak how the L10s Ultra works with your home.

Like the iRobot Roomba S9+ and Roborock Q Revo, the L10s Ultra uses a combination of LIDAR and camera-based navigation techniques to map out your home. This produces a precise floor plan that enables the robot vacuum and mop effectively without getting stuck in messy areas. The LIDAR also lets the robot vacuum detect and avoid obstacles which is a great feature for families with pets or children.

The L10s Ultra has a solid vacuuming capability, clearing 98.4% of debris from our test on the hard floor and taking best buy robot vacuum out all but the most difficult juice stains. The mops also work well in removing 98.4 percent of debris from our carpet, tile, and wood tests. However, it wasn't quite as great at tackling sand on the hard floor and the quaker oats that are on carpet.
